chromafx
Version:
CHROMAFX is a powerful and flexible terminal color and style management library. It offers a wide range of color options, including basic, bright, background, and 256-color palette support, as well as custom RGB colors. The package allows easy application
90 lines (68 loc) • 2.53 kB
Markdown
<h1 align="center">
<br>
<img width="320" src="img/Untitled design.png" alt="ChromaFX">
<br>
<br>
</h1>
-
-
-
-
-
-
**ChromaFX** is a powerful and easy-to-use Node.js library for adding colorful and styled text to your console output. With over 20+ colors and various text styles, you can make your terminal output more visually appealing and easier to read.
<h1 align="center">
<br>
<img width="320" src="img/PASTE.png" alt="ChromaFX">
<br>
</h1>
- **Wide Color Palette:** Access over 20+ colors, including basic, bright, and extended 256-color palette options.
- **Text Styles:** Apply bold, italic, underline, and strikethrough styles to your text.
- **Easy to Use:** Simple API for quick and intuitive usage.
- **Lightweight:** Minimal overhead with no dependencies.
You can install ChromaFX using npm:
```bash
> npm install chromafx
```
```javascript
const c = require('chromafx');
// Basic Colors
console.log(c.red('Red Text'));
console.log(c.green('Green Text'));
// Bright Colors
console.log(c.brightBlue('Bright Blue Text'));
// Extended Colors
console.log(c.orange('Orange Text'));
console.log(c.pink('Pink Text'));
// Text Styles
console.log(c.bold('Bold Text'));
console.log(c.italic('Italic Text'));
console.log(c.underline('Underlined Text'));
console.log(c.strikethrough('Strikethrough Text'));
// Combining Colors and Styles
console.log(c.red(c.bold('Bold Red Text')));
console.log(c.blue(c.underline('Underlined Blue Text')));
```
- black, red, green, yellow, blue, magenta, cyan, white
- brightBlack, brightRed, brightGreen, brightYellow, brightBlue, brightMagenta, brightCyan, brightWhite
- orange, pink, purple, brown, lightBlue, lightGreen, lightCyan, lightRed, lightMagenta, lightYellow, gray, darkGray, gold, silver, olive, teal, violet, coral
- bold, italic, underline, strikethrough
<h1 align="center">
<br>
<img width="640" src="img/EXMAPLE.jpg" alt="example">
<img width="640" src="img/EXMAPLEc.jpg" alt="result">
<img width="640" src="img/EXMAPLEv.jpg" alt="result">
<br>
</h1>
